We are currently recruiting on behalf of a forward-thinking private training Provider for a Hospitality Coach.Job Purpose The role of the Hospitality Coach is to coach, guide and mentor apprentices enrolled onto the Hospitality programme to ensure their timely progress towards End Point Assessment. Working in partnership with the apprentice’s line manager, you are responsible for planning activities and providing coaching to ensure the development of skills and knowledge relevant to the Hospitality apprenticeship standard up to L4.Job Role:

  • To train, guide and mentor learners enrolled onto the Hospitality programmes and to ensure their timely progress.
  • You will also be accountable for making reasonable adjustments to meet the individual needs of learners across a wide variety of provisions.
  • Mark/assess learners’ work, provide structured feedback and set and agree development objectives with all key stakeholders.
  • Travel to see learners within their place of work. You will be working with a large chain of hotels and you will be the main coach for this company.
  • Accurately track progress of all learners and effectively risk band their timely progress and achievement using additional learner support funds and tools, where necessary, to ensure learners are not disadvantaged.
  • Support learners with their functional skills by embedding this into your delivery.
  • Account manage the client caseload to ensure we retain business, facilitate progression and secure new business
